Pascal Madevon, a Bordeaux-trained winemaker who now calls BC home, brings his skills to make a magnificent red blend wine for the Okanagan’s French Door Estate Winery. The winery was founded in 2019 and is already producing impressive wines.  I received a bottle of French Door Estate Winery’s héritage French Blend 2020, which contains just about every major red Bordeaux…

Bordeaux blends are popular around the world.  Many wineries make Bordeaux blends in BC, but few have a winemaker from Bordeaux!  One such winery is French Door Estate Winery, a family-run winery founded in 2019 just south of Oliver, BC, on the Black Sage Bench.  They are extremely fortunate to have Pascal Madevon as its winemaker.  As I mentioned Pascal…
